      Re: An Open Challenge to Norman Geisler

      Quote Originally posted by Teluog View Post
      You'd think that Geisler should be picking on Enns instead of Licona.
      Well, to play Geisler’s advocate for a second, I think I know where he might be coming from when it comes to things like this.

      Licona is on the inside of Evangelicalism whereas Enns is out (H/T Manwe for this awful punn). Granting Geisler his huge whopper of a premise that Licona’s view of Scripture his highly corrosive to our view of the authority of Scripture, Licona (given that premise, mind you) is likely more of a threat to Evangelicalism than Enns is. We can see that Enn's view is clearly at odds with a high view of the authority of Scripture and are not likely to be taken in by it; not so (given Geisler’s premise) with Licona.

      Now, of course, I think the premise I granted for the sake of argument above is way off base to begin with. But still, I can see why his reasoning from that premise could easily take him to the position that Licona is more of a threat to Evangelicalism than are many outsiders.
